||||
|
||||
// Package credentials provides credential retrieval and management
|
||||
// for S3 compatible object storage.
|
||||
//
|
||||
// By default the Credentials.Get() will cache the successful result of a
|
||||
// Provider's Retrieve() until Provider.IsExpired() returns true. At which
|
||||
// point Credentials will call Provider's Retrieve() to get new credential Value.
|
||||
//
|
||||
// The Provider is responsible for determining when credentials have expired.
|
||||
// It is also important to note that Credentials will always call Retrieve the
|
||||
// first time Credentials.Get() is called.
|
||||
//
|
||||
// Example of using the environment variable credentials.
|
||||
//
|
||||
// creds := NewFromEnv()
|
||||
// // Retrieve the credentials value
|
||||
// credValue, err := creds.Get()
|
||||
// if err != nil {
|
||||
// // handle error
|
||||
// }
|
||||
//
|
||||
// Example of forcing credentials to expire and be refreshed on the next Get().
|
||||
// This may be helpful to proactively expire credentials and refresh them sooner
|
||||
// than they would naturally expire on their own.
|
||||
//
|
||||
// creds := NewFromIAM("")
|
||||
// creds.Expire()
|
||||
// credsValue, err := creds.Get()
|
||||
// // New credentials will be retrieved instead of from cache.
|
||||
//
|
||||
//
|
||||
// Custom Provider
|
||||
//
|
||||
// Each Provider built into this package also provides a helper method to generate
|
||||
// a Credentials pointer setup with the provider. To use a custom Provider just
|
||||
// create a type which satisfies the Provider interface and pass it to the
|
||||
// NewCredentials method.
|
||||
//
|
||||
// type MyProvider struct{}
|
||||
// func (m *MyProvider) Retrieve() (Value, error) {...}
|
||||
// func (m *MyProvider) IsExpired() bool {...}
|
||||
//
|
||||
// creds := NewCredentials(&MyProvider{})
|
||||
// credValue, err := creds.Get()
|
||||
//
|
||||
package credentials
